Use software and tools 

One of the best ways to improve collaboration in the workplace is to utilize new tools and software. These various platforms can be used to work together on projects, as well as to connect with suppliers and customers. From communication software to e-procurement and appointment setting, there are a variety of different options out there that can significantly benefit your business.

Encourage team building

Team building is an important way for your employees to learn about each other’s strengths and weaknesses. This creates a cohesive workforce that encourages and fosters a productive work environment. Role model and establish trust

As leaders, it’s vital that you remember to role model how you would like your employees to behave. If you wish to see more collaboration, then you are going to need to show that you are also available. Answer questions, involve yourself in decision-making, and promote ongoing learning. This will build trust between yourself and your employees and encourage them to seek help from others. 

Offer rewards and share successes

Another great way to encourage collaboration is to offer rewards to your employees. This way, they are feel accomplished and rewarded for their hard work. For example, you might consider taking everyone out for dinner or buying them lunch. It can also be wise to provide specific employee incentives, which can increase productivity and morale. This could include health insurance, paid time off, and flexible work hours.

Build a cohesive team

As mentioned above, it’s important to create a cohesive workforce. In order to achieve this, try and form group tasks and teams that work well together. Not everyone is going to get along, so you want to ensure that everyone’s individual personalities support and blend together. Support a sense of community

Lastly, while it is important to encourage team building to promote productivity, it’s also vital to support a sense of community. When individuals enjoy coming into the office with their peers, employee turnover is reduced, and company culture is improved. In turn, this will help everyone to work together collaboratively.
